The Atlanta Braves won the series opener against the Seattle Mariners on Friday. Entering Saturday’s game, though, Braves manager Brian Snitker decided to make an interesting change to his batting order. Ronald Acuña Jr. has dealt with injuries throughout the season, putting him in a slump at the plate. To fix that, Jurickson Profar will leadoff with Acuña Jr. bats sixth.

The All-Star outfielder is one of the best leadoff hitters in Major League Baseball when healthy.
